The correct Answer is:
A, D

`(dy)/(dx) -ytanx=2xsecx`
`therefore cosx(dy)/(dx) + (-sinx)y=2x`
`therefore d/(dx)(ycosx)=2x`
Integrating, we get
`y(x)cosx=x^(2)+c`, where c=0 since y(0)=0
When `x=pi/4, y(pi/4)= pi^(2)/(8sqrt(2))`
When `x=pi/3, y(pi/3)=(2pi^(2))/9`
When `x=pi/4, y^(')(pi/4)=pi^(2)/(8sqrt(2))+pi/sqrt(2)`
When `x=pi/3, y^(')(pi/3)=(2pi^(2))/(3sqrt(3))+(4pi)/3`
